jenkins-bot has submitted this change. ( https://gerrit.wikimedia.org/r/c/pywikibot/core/+/1064016?usp=email )
Change subject: [doc] update documentation ...................................................................... [doc] update documentation Change-Id: I2d686feebaa5432c7ee3b5ff7385ad94ca461179 --- M docs/introduction.rst M docs/mwapi.rst M pywikibot/scripts/__init__.py M pywikibot/scripts/preload_sites.py M pywikibot/scripts/shell.py 5 files changed, 53 insertions(+), 40 deletions(-) Approvals: Xqt: Looks good to me, approved jenkins-bot: Verified diff --git a/docs/introduction.rst b/docs/introduction.rst index a10f78e..70bf537 100644 --- a/docs/introduction.rst +++ b/docs/introduction.rst @@ -41,4 +41,4 @@ * :manpage:`i18n` Manual * `MediaWiki Language Codes <https://www.mediawiki.org/wiki/Manual:Language#Language_code>`_ * :ref:`User Interface Settings` - * :py:mod:`pywikibot.i18n` + * :mod:`i18n` diff --git a/docs/mwapi.rst b/docs/mwapi.rst index 887b0ba7..8852829 100644 --- a/docs/mwapi.rst +++ b/docs/mwapi.rst @@ -62,41 +62,9 @@ - :meth:`BasePage.expand_text()<page.BasePage.expand_text>` - :meth:`textlib.getCategoryLinks` * - :api:`flow<flow>` - - :meth:`load_board()<pywikibot.site._extensions.FlowMixin.load_board>` - :meth:`load_topiclist()<pywikibot.site._extensions.FlowMixin.load_topiclist>` - :meth:`load_topic()<pywikibot.site._extensions.FlowMixin.load_topic>` - :meth:`load_post_current_revision()<pywikibot.site._extensions.FlowMixin.load_post_current_revision>` - :meth:`create_new_topic()<pywikibot.site._extensions.FlowMixin.create_new_topic>` - :meth:`reply_to_post()<pywikibot.site._extensions.FlowMixin.reply_to_post>` |br| - :meth:`lock_topic()<pywikibot.site._extensions.FlowMixin.lock_topic>` - :meth:`moderate_topic()<pywikibot.site._extensions.FlowMixin.moderate_topic>` - :meth:`delete_topic()<pywikibot.site._extensions.FlowMixin.delete_topic>` |br| - :meth:`hide_topic()<pywikibot.site._extensions.FlowMixin.hide_topic>` - :meth:`suppress_topic()<pywikibot.site._extensions.FlowMixin.suppress_topic>` - :meth:`restore_topic()<pywikibot.site._extensions.FlowMixin.restore_topic>` - :meth:`moderate_post()<pywikibot.site._extensions.FlowMixin.moderate_post>` - :meth:`delete_post()<pywikibot.site._extensions.FlowMixin.delete_post>` |br| - :meth:`hide_post()<pywikibot.site._extensions.FlowMixin.hide_post>` |br| - :meth:`suppress_post()<pywikibot.site._extensions.FlowMixin.suppress_post>` - :meth:`restore_post()<pywikibot.site._extensions.FlowMixin.restore_post>` + - *deprecated, see below* - - - :meth:`flow.Board.topics` - :meth:`flow.Topic.create_topic` - :meth:`flow.Topic.lock` - :meth:`flow.Topic.unlock` - :meth:`flow.Topic.delete_mod` - :meth:`flow.Topic.hide` - :meth:`flow.Topic.suppress` - :meth:`flow.Topic.retore` - :meth:`flow.Post.reply` - :meth:`flow.Post.delete` - :meth:`flow.Post.hide` - :meth:`flow.Post.suppress` - :meth:`flow.Post.restore` - * - :api:`flowthank<flowthank>` - - :meth:`thank_post()<pywikibot.site._extensions.ThanksFlowMixin.thank_post>` - - - :meth:`flow.Post.thank` * - :api:`login<login>` - :meth:`login()<pywikibot.site._apisite.APISite.login>` - @@ -170,3 +138,51 @@ - :meth:`watch()<pywikibot.site._apisite.APISite.watch>` - :meth:`BasePage.watch()<page.BasePage.watch>` - + +Flow support +============ + +.. deprecated:: 9.4 + will be removed with Pywikibot 12 or earlier (:phab:`T371180`). + +.. list-table:: + :header-rows: 1 + :align: left + + * - action + - APISite method + - flow module method + * - :api:`flow<flow>` + - :meth:`load_board()<pywikibot.site._extensions.FlowMixin.load_board>` |br| + :meth:`load_topiclist()<pywikibot.site._extensions.FlowMixin.load_topiclist>` |br| + :meth:`load_topic()<pywikibot.site._extensions.FlowMixin.load_topic>` |br| + :meth:`load_post_current_revision()<pywikibot.site._extensions.FlowMixin.load_post_current_revision>` |br| + :meth:`create_new_topic()<pywikibot.site._extensions.FlowMixin.create_new_topic>` |br| + :meth:`reply_to_post()<pywikibot.site._extensions.FlowMixin.reply_to_post>` |br| + :meth:`lock_topic()<pywikibot.site._extensions.FlowMixin.lock_topic>` |br| + :meth:`moderate_topic()<pywikibot.site._extensions.FlowMixin.moderate_topic>` |br| + :meth:`delete_topic()<pywikibot.site._extensions.FlowMixin.delete_topic>` |br| + :meth:`hide_topic()<pywikibot.site._extensions.FlowMixin.hide_topic>` |br| + :meth:`suppress_topic()<pywikibot.site._extensions.FlowMixin.suppress_topic>` |br| + :meth:`restore_topic()<pywikibot.site._extensions.FlowMixin.restore_topic>` |br| + :meth:`moderate_post()<pywikibot.site._extensions.FlowMixin.moderate_post>` |br| + :meth:`delete_post()<pywikibot.site._extensions.FlowMixin.delete_post>` |br| + :meth:`hide_post()<pywikibot.site._extensions.FlowMixin.hide_post>` |br| + :meth:`suppress_post()<pywikibot.site._extensions.FlowMixin.suppress_post>` |br| + :meth:`restore_post()<pywikibot.site._extensions.FlowMixin.restore_post>` |br| + - :meth:`flow.Board.topics` |br| + :meth:`flow.Topic.create_topic` |br| + :meth:`flow.Topic.lock` |br| + :meth:`flow.Topic.unlock` |br| + :meth:`flow.Topic.delete_mod` |br| + :meth:`flow.Topic.hide` |br| + :meth:`flow.Topic.suppress` |br| + :meth:`flow.Topic.restore` |br| + :meth:`flow.Post.reply` |br| + :meth:`flow.Post.delete` |br| + :meth:`flow.Post.hide` |br| + :meth:`flow.Post.suppress` |br| + :meth:`flow.Post.restore` |br| + * - :api:`flowthank<flowthank>` + - :meth:`thank_post()<pywikibot.site._extensions.ThanksFlowMixin.thank_post>` + - :meth:`flow.Post.thank` diff --git a/pywikibot/scripts/__init__.py b/pywikibot/scripts/__init__.py index 5428813..fabe48b 100644 --- a/pywikibot/scripts/__init__.py +++ b/pywikibot/scripts/__init__.py @@ -1,8 +1,5 @@ """Folder which holds framework scripts. -When uploading pywikibot to pypi the pwb.py (wrapper script) and -pywikibot i18n package are copied here. - .. versionadded:: 7.0 """ # diff --git a/pywikibot/scripts/preload_sites.py b/pywikibot/scripts/preload_sites.py index 27a31f7..6bd3b66 100755 --- a/pywikibot/scripts/preload_sites.py +++ b/pywikibot/scripts/preload_sites.py @@ -3,7 +3,7 @@ The following parameters are supported: --worker:<num> The number of parallel tasks to be run. Default is the + -worker:<num> The number of parallel tasks to be run. Default is the number of processors on the machine **Usage:** diff --git a/pywikibot/scripts/shell.py b/pywikibot/scripts/shell.py index 399c5c4..2751e3a 100755 --- a/pywikibot/scripts/shell.py +++ b/pywikibot/scripts/shell.py @@ -4,9 +4,9 @@ To exit the shell, type :kbd:`ctrl-D` (Linux) or :kbd:`ctrl-Z` (Windows) or use the :func:`exit` function. -The following local option is supported:: +The following local option is supported: - -noimport Do not import the pywikibot library. All other arguments are +-noimport Do not import the pywikibot library. All other arguments are ignored in this case. Usage:: -- To view, visit https://gerrit.wikimedia.org/r/c/pywikibot/core/+/1064016?usp=email To unsubscribe, or for help writing mail filters, visit https://gerrit.wikimedia.org/r/settings?usp=email Gerrit-MessageType: merged Gerrit-Project: pywikibot/core Gerrit-Branch: master Gerrit-Change-Id: I2d686feebaa5432c7ee3b5ff7385ad94ca461179 Gerrit-Change-Number: 1064016 Gerrit-PatchSet: 1 Gerrit-Owner: Xqt <i...@gno.de> Gerrit-Reviewer: Xqt <i...@gno.de> Gerrit-Reviewer: jenkins-bot
_______________________________________________ Pywikibot-commits mailing list -- pywikibot-commits@lists.wikimedia.org To unsubscribe send an email to pywikibot-commits-le...@lists.wikimedia.org